An unexpected surge.

September new-car sales rebounded to their perkiest pace since April, surprising industry watchers, and, frankly, anyone else who is at all aware of the overall economic picture, which seems to be fading back into recession. Pent-up demand seems to be the consensus explanation for the unexpected surge. That would appear to be more business demand than consumer demand, given the jump in truck sales. The good news is that automakers didn't have to buy those sales with big incentives, as incentive spending declined slightly (although it increased at Toyota and Honda). Overall volume beat last September's total by 10%.
